Output d5865407a64605613179e21f0840e045ba7ac85c3ed98a8b12708f4008dea077:62

value
60165005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8ad9d2d25e949e120f3db88431c5c158ecb6fe OP_EQUAL
address
3JhMwka1noq81F6W2ywP1LeLT4DBqGxJ7T
transaction
d5865407a64605613179e21f0840e045ba7ac85c3ed98a8b12708f4008dea077
spent
true